Calf
augmentation
Calf augmentation is a surgical
procedure performed to enlarge one or both calves for various
reasons:
- To enhance the body
contour of a man or a woman, who, for personal reasons
believes their calves to be too small.
- To correct a loss in calf
volume after trauma or other difficulty.
- To balance calf size, when
there exists a significant difference between the size of
the calves.
- To restore shape after
volume loss to the calf for various conditions.
Calf augmentation is accomplished
by inserting a semisolid silicone implant below the investing
fascia and above the functioning muscles. An incision is placed
behind the knee, which will virtually disappear in months. The
shape and size of the calves prior to surgery will influence
both the recommended treatment as well as the final result.
